CRESTOR is a trademark of the AstraZeneca group of companies. Rosuvastatin calcium is manufactured under license from Shionogi & CO, Ltd, Osaka, Japan.

Crestor (rosuvastatin) is used to modify abnormal levels of fatty substances in the blood, mainly high levels of cholesterol and triglycerides, ...
